## Deployment

QueueCrest, our queue-depth autoscaler, deploys as a single controller per cluster via the standard release pipeline. Verify the metrics scrape is healthy before promoting, and confirm scale events appear in the audit log within two minutes. Rollback restores the prior controller image without touching existing replica counts. The controller starts with the following configuration values.

service settings:
PRAIX_LOG_LEVEL=error
PRAIX_METRICS_HOST=metrics.praix.qorvelcorp.corp
PRAIX_POOL_SIZE=16

Roof-Terrace Door — Night Shift Visitor Policy. The terrace door on Level 9 of Calloway House jams when the temperature drops; visitors must not be sent up alone to force it. Escort any after-hours visitor personally and log them in the Brightmoor register first. If the door sticks, push at the hinge side, then swipe again — do not prop it open. Terrace access ends at 22:00 sharp. Contractors from Venner Group are the only exception. The override pass for a jammed latch is below.

staff pass of kawip-hawef = bdg-QLP-2

Off-site run checklist — Marnwick Labs calibration batch

- [ ] Double-check the crate of calibration weights from the Marnwick metrology room (twelve pieces, each in its foam sleeve). They're heavier than they look, so grab the trolley from the loading bay, not the hand basket.
- [ ] Confirm the sign-out sheet is stapled to the lid — Priya was fussy about that last time.
- [ ] Courier from Deltabridge Express arrives around 10:15.

Before the driver leaves, make sure they follow the hand-over instruction below.

drop instructions, yafog-yawip: the quenmir olidor courier leaves the julox tamion keliel ledger at gate 5283 under passcode 336825

Ticket: Harden formula sandbox before GA

User-supplied formulas in Tallyridge sheets can currently reach the host clock and environment. Proposed fix constrains the interpreter to the Quartzfen sandbox profile. Release manager: please hold the GA cut until this merges. The candidate fix is identified by the build token below.

pipeline stamp: htk9_ce63042d9